    What a dire response.

    The Xara Slidehow Widget is hosted at https://widgets.xara-online.com/slider/index.php and technically one can login directly, bypassing the Xara application.

    The worry I have is in the URL and the login.
    The URL uses a Token, which I am sure will expire when the Update Service lapses.
    The login will therefore fail.

    For an existing site, using the slideshow, there would have to be a read-only aspect that renders the slideshow but denies update access. I have seen no evidence of this.
    Are there any TGers who are Update Service lapsers and have websites that use the Xara Slideshow Widget?

    The EULA is quite specific:
    D. UPDATE SERVICE
    The license for updates and features delivered within the scope of the Update Service is limited to the installation(s) in place at the first anniversary of the initial registration of the Software, or at the date of last renewal if that is more recent. It will therefore terminate if you re-install the software after the Update Service has lapsed, and you will fall back to the version of the software at the date of your initial purchase and registration, or the date of last renewal if that is more recent. These limitations do not apply if you extend the Update Service beyond the initial 12-month period.

    Any online services included in the Software (M hosting, Xara Online Designer and the Online Content Catalog) will end as soon as the Update Service expires, unless the Update Service is extended beyond the initial 12-month period.
    The giveaway is the URL. So without something in writing in the Help, the live slideshow site or the EULA, you are out on a limb.

    The proof of the pudding was a promise by Kate Moir to restore the Xara Slideshow Widget, which has been done only for v15.
    It is all too easy for Xara to remove a widget from the On-line Content Catalogue, as proven, and you are forced to resubscribe or update to a later version.

    Insert > From Content Catalogue > Components: Slideshow --> Import Xara Slideshow Widget.

    Log in & Load one of your slideshows. finally, click the Insert button.
    You will then have a Placeholder with a Preview and selecting Edit (Widget) takes you back to the slideshow edit page.

    The Placeholder head is:
    </script><script type="text/javascript" src="https://widgets.xara-online.com/slider/js/mxslider.js"></script>
    The Placeholder body is:
    <div class="mxSlider" style="width:100%;height:100%;" data-slideshowid="***********************" data-r="*********************"></div>

    Why the head starts with a spurious terminate style Tag has eluded me; the slideshow still works when it is deleted.
    Equally, the data-r parameter may only to keep the slideshow editor state between edits.
